소개

노란 부리와 초록 날개를 가진 작은 갈색 청둥오리. 노란부리청둥오리와 밀접하게 관련이 있으며 때로 아종으로 취급된다. 콜롬비아, 에콰도르, 페루의 안데스 습지에 서식한다.

식별

깃털

Brown body with fine dark spotting; head grayish-brown. Yellow bill with darker culmen. Iridescent green speculum with white front border. Legs grayish-orange. Sexes similar. High-altitude Andean specialist.

Habitat & Range

High-altitude freshwater lakes, marshes, and boggy streams at 2,500–4,500 m in the Andes of Colombia, Ecuador, and Peru. Strongly associated with paramo and subpáramo wetlands.

소리

노래

Male gives a clear, whistled note; female produces a soft quacking series. Subdued vocalizations of this high-altitude Andes teal blend with the wind across paramo lakes.
